Output 625f3540c07da41f1fbc735f540cc8f7e0831d01a441784fd1e5b4765146b25b:2

value
27309320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ee766b591c7bd286edc4f4d2d4f2419534da21 OP_EQUAL
address
MMZvagaKSJWHyrGYvToVdWqNCotSZRezyY
transaction
625f3540c07da41f1fbc735f540cc8f7e0831d01a441784fd1e5b4765146b25b
spent
true